the history of chip architecture and the development of ai technology

For nearly 80 years, modern chip architecture has been built on the basis of a concept introduced by John von Neumann in 1945. This concept separates processing and memory units, then moves data between the two continuously to carry out instructions. This approach is the foundation of various computing devices, ranging from mainframe computers, desktops, to data centers. However, the development of artificial intelligence (AI) began to show the limitations of the model.

On a neural network, millions of parameters are processed simultaneously. In wearable devices, data transfer between memory and processor actually consumes more than 90 percent of the chip’s power consumption, so that the remaining energy for computing is very minimal. To answer the challenge, Anker Innovations presented a new approach by placing the computational process directly in the Nor Flash memory cell, the location where the AI model was stored.

With this method, the model parameters no longer need to be moved back and forth, so that power consumption can be focused entirely on the AI computing process. The AI chip was first introduced through the earbuds and is claimed to be able to deliver AI computing performance up to 150 times higher for the environmental noise cancellation feature compared to the previous Anker flagship earphone generation.

New AI features and innovations offered

The first feature that this chip brings is Clear Calls, which runs a large neural network completely on-device. The technology is supported by eight MEMS microphones and two bone conduction sensors to produce clearer call sound quality in various environmental conditions. In addition, Anker also introduced other AI features such as Signature Sound and Voice Control in the Anker Day event.

The first earbuds to use AI thus chips are the Soundcore Liberty 5 Pro and Liberty 5 Pro Max. Both devices are equipped with the Whisper Clear Calls feature that relies on the AI Neural Network model with a total of 10 sensors to capture more clearly in various situations. Call quality technology has even obtained Guinness World Record certification.

Especially for the Liberty 5 Pro Max, this device also brings the innovation of the world’s first smart screen earbuds equipped with AI Note-taker. Through the 1.78-inch AMOLED screen on the casing, the device can record meetings, make automatic transcripts, to summarize Action Items directly on the device without the need for a cloud connection. This product is scheduled to be present in Indonesia in June.

Anker Day 2026 and the latest innovations

Meanwhile, Anker Innovations itself again held the Anker Day 2026 with the theme Where Ultimate Meets Possible in Storied, New York City. In this year’s event, Anker introduced a number of innovations from various brands under his auspices. From the Soundcore line, there are Liberty 5 Pro and Liberty 5 Pro Max which are the first earbuds with the support of AI thus chips.

In addition, the AI VibeOS and Spaceflow Nebula platforms were also introduced. From the energy line, the Anker Solix S2000 is present as a home power back-up station with a capacity of 2kWh with the longest claimed durability in the world. Meanwhile, Eufy presents EdgeAgent, an AI-based home security agent, and the latest Smart Baby Care products.

All of these innovations are indeed supported by AI thus, Anker’s AI chip platform which is known as the world’s first neural network-based AI compute-in-memory chip.

Anker Innovations Journey

Anker’s own journey starts from the power bank product. The company, which was founded in 2011, launched a 4,500mAh ultra-thin power bank in 2012 as its first product. From there, Anker continues to develop various charging technologies and electronic devices that focus on high performance and compact design.

A number of innovation milestones were later born, ranging from PowerIQ technology for fast charging across devices, the use of gallium nitride (GAN) material on the charger, to the development of high-power ultra-compact chargers. Anker also introduced Ganprime, a smart power distribution system for multi-port chargers, 240W wall chargers, Instacord retractable cable technology, to Ultradura which focuses on device durability.
